Summary of major points so far:
- program execution begins at main()
- keywords are written in lower-case
- statements are terminated with a semi-colon
- text strings are enclosed in double quotes
- C is cse sensitive, use lower-case and try not to capitalise
variable names
- \n means position the cursor on the beginning of the
next line
- printf() can be used to display text to the screen
- the curly braces {} define the beginning and end of
a program block
